Need help on Streaming Dataset
Hi All,
I'm creating Streaming datasets using python. I've created streaming dataset to stream one value which is working fine. But when I tried stream multiple values in line chart it's not working. Please help me on this.
Source is - MemSQL
import requests
from datetime import datetime
import time
import psutil
import simplejson as json
import pymysql
import pandas as pd
from pathlib import Path
import schedule
directory =str(Path.home())
connection = pymysql.connect(user="******",
passwd="******",
host="*******",
port=****,
database="******"
)
cur = connection.cursor()
def my_func():
cur.execute("select revenue,order,hour,minute from sample_table")
ls = []
for l in cur.fetchall():
dict_qs = {}
dict_qs['revenue'] = l[0]
dict_qs['order'] = l[1]
dict_qs['hour'] = l[2]
dict_qs['minute'] = l[3]
ls.append(l)
print(dict_qs)
json_data = [{
"Revenue": dict_qs['revenue']
"Order":dict_qs['order']
"Hour":dict_qs['hour']
"Minute":dict_qs['minute']
}]
res = requests.post('Power BI Streaming API', data=json.dumps(json_data))
print(res.status_code)
schedule.every(10).seconds.do(my_func)
while True:
schedule.run_pending()
time.sleep(5)
